Bug description:
  Binary package hint: pingus

  The music in this game doesn't play correctly. It's as if part of the instruments or tracks are muted.
  I've had this problem before in earlier versions (before 9.10) of Ubuntu. It worked correctly in 9.10. Now, in Ubuntu 10.04 (x64) this problem has been reintroduced.

  Some more data:
  Ubuntu release: Ubuntu 10.04 x64
  Package version of pingus: 0.7.2-4ubuild1
  Motherboard: Asus P5B. I use onboard audio (analog stereo duplex)
